首页
学习
活动
专区
圈层
工具
发布

dedecms样式引入

DedeCMS(织梦内容管理系统)是一款流行的开源内容管理系统(CMS),它允许用户通过简单的操作来创建和管理网站内容。在DedeCMS中,样式引入通常指的是将CSS文件引入到网站的HTML页面中,以便应用样式和布局。

基础概念

CSS(层叠样式表)是一种用来描述HTML或XML(包括SVG、XHTML等)文档样式的样式表语言。通过CSS,开发者可以控制网页的布局、颜色、字体等视觉效果。

相关优势

  1. 代码分离:将样式与内容分离,使得HTML结构更加清晰,便于维护。
  2. 样式复用:通过外部CSS文件,可以在多个页面之间共享样式,减少重复代码。
  3. 易于维护:修改样式时只需更改CSS文件,而不需要修改每个HTML页面。

类型

  1. 内部样式表:将CSS代码直接写在HTML文档的<head>部分。
  2. 内部样式表:将CSS代码直接写在HTML文档的<head>部分。
  3. 外部样式表:将CSS代码写入一个单独的文件(如style.css),然后在HTML文档中通过<link>标签引入。
  4. 外部样式表:将CSS代码写入一个单独的文件(如style.css),然后在HTML文档中通过<link>标签引入。

应用场景

  • 网站设计:通过CSS控制网站的整体风格和布局。
  • 响应式设计:使用媒体查询(Media Queries)实现不同设备上的自适应布局。
  • 动画效果:通过CSS3实现简单的动画效果。

常见问题及解决方法

问题:样式未生效

原因

  1. CSS文件路径错误。
  2. CSS选择器错误。
  3. CSS代码有语法错误。
  4. 浏览器缓存问题。

解决方法

  1. 检查CSS文件的路径是否正确,确保文件能够被正确加载。
  2. 检查CSS文件的路径是否正确,确保文件能够被正确加载。
  3. 确保CSS选择器正确匹配HTML元素。
  4. 确保CSS选择器正确匹配HTML元素。
  5. 检查CSS代码是否有语法错误,如缺少分号、括号不匹配等。
  6. 检查CSS代码是否有语法错误,如缺少分号、括号不匹配等。
  7. 清除浏览器缓存或使用无痕模式查看效果。

问题:样式冲突

原因

  1. 多个CSS文件中定义了相同的样式规则。
  2. 内联样式覆盖了外部样式。

解决方法

  1. 使用更具体的选择器来覆盖其他样式。
  2. 使用更具体的选择器来覆盖其他样式。
  3. 避免内联样式覆盖外部样式,尽量使用外部样式表。

示例代码

以下是一个简单的DedeCMS页面引入外部CSS文件的示例:

代码语言:txt
复制
<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<title>示例页面</title>
    <link rel="stylesheet" type="text/css" href="/css/style.css">
</head>
<body>
    <h1>欢迎来到DedeCMS</h1>
    <p>这是一个简单的示例页面。</p>
</body>
</html>

参考链接

通过以上信息,您可以更好地理解DedeCMS中样式引入的基础概念、优势、类型、应用场景以及常见问题的解决方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的文章

领券